Hilfsverben: Eine Minimalistische Analyse Am Beispiel Des Italienischen Und Sardischen

By (author) Eva-Maria Remberger





This book is currently unavailable. Enquire to check if we can source a used copy


| book description |

This study is an application of Chomsky's minimalist program (1995) to the universally relevant phenomenon of auxiliarity, restricted here to verb auxiliarity. It provides detailed minimalist analyses of auxiliary verb constructions in two Romance languages (Italian and Sardinian). The theoretical framework is supplied by Generative Grammar, and in the course of the book a number of modifications to this framework are proposed. Approaches based on grammaticalization theory also play a role in the analysis and interpretation of auxiliary verbs.
